Transaction 13c853377d083cb2fb7d8b26bc707983e2504051cebb99a60516ab240be64b13
1 Input
1 Output
-
13c853377d083cb2fb7d8b26bc707983e2504051cebb99a60516ab240be64b13:0
- value
- 4596409
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 762485113d4190befd34ffef3f24ccc77073c935 OP_EQUAL
- address
- 3CThQctNVewCf8dmWtHTd1T6TY6mj5adst